Method: projects.locations.collections.engines.patch

Actualiza un Engine.

Solicitud HTTP

PATCH https://discoveryengine.googleapis.com/v1/{engine.name=projects/*/locations/*/collections/*/engines/*}

La URL utiliza la sintaxis de transcodificación a gRPC.

Parámetros de ruta

Parámetros
engine.name

string

Inmutable. Identificador. Nombre completo del recurso del motor.

Este campo debe ser una cadena codificada en UTF-8 con un límite de 1024 caracteres.

Formato: projects/{project}/locations/{location}/collections/{collection}/engines/{engine} engine debe tener entre 1 y 63 caracteres, y los caracteres válidos son /[a-z0-9][a-z0-9-_]*/. De lo contrario, se devuelve un error INVALID_ARGUMENT.

Los parámetros de consulta

Parámetros
updateMask

string (FieldMask format)

Indica qué campos del Engine proporcionado se van a actualizar.

Si se proporciona un campo no admitido o desconocido, se devuelve un error INVALID_ARGUMENT.

Es una lista de nombres completos de campos separados por comas. Ejemplo: "user.displayName,photo"

Cuerpo de la solicitud

En el cuerpo de la solicitud se incluye una instancia de Engine.

Cuerpo de la respuesta

Si la solicitud se hace correctamente, en el cuerpo de la respuesta se incluye una instancia de Engine.

Permisos de autorización

Debes disponer de uno de los siguientes permisos de OAuth:

  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/discoveryengine.readwrite

Para obtener más información, consulta el Authentication Overview.

Permisos de IAM

Requiere el siguiente permiso de gestión de identidades y accesos en el recurso name:

  • discoveryengine.engines.update

Para obtener más información, consulta la documentación de gestión de identidades y accesos.